Branch Administrator
Dobbs Equipment is seeking a Branch Administrator to perform a full range of administrative and sales support duties for their dealership location. The role involves managing payroll, providing administrative support across departments, and assisting customers while ensuring a well-organized branch environment.

Responsibilities
Enter payroll hours for service team daily, process payroll for branch weekly. (ADP Function)
Provides administrative support to all branch departments including parts, sales, and service
Handles incoming and outgoing phone calls and email correspondence through the branch
Assists walk-in customers by learning basic qualifying questions for rentals/demos/sales to generate business
Coordinate with local vendors such as plumbing, A/C, and landscaping to ensure services are properly completed
Ensures the store presents a good image to customers and staff including stocking goods such as literature displays, coffee pods, printer paper, ink, organization of storage closet, and other office items
Take lead on branch events, customer appreciation events and such
Deposit cash daily and manage petty cash
Issue purchase orders and approve invoices when necessary
Work with DHQ to open customers in-house and Power Plan accounts
Reconcile credit card statement for P-Card
Set up new vendor account with DHQ when needed
Check requests
Create customer invoices including Ad-hoc invoices when needed
Assists Salesman & General Manager in collecting on aged accounts
Work closely with Credit and Payments and customer to keep accounts <60 days- Customer account deep dives including calling reps at PP to help resolve issues on accounts, matching, requesting credits etc
Participate in a weekly A/R call with Headquarters
Complete accurate and timely records including rental agreements, DEMO agreements, requests, filing, and correspondence with DHQ
Focus on support for territory managers and ISR’s with all types of customer or equipment issues
Interact with company personnel to assist in locating equipment and determining availability within the branch and other branches
Create customer invoices including proforma invoices when needed
Become familiar with DIT (Dealer Inventory Tracking) and act as a backup to branch ISR regarding inventory and yard duties
Assist sales team with hiring haulers for equipment transfers / rental moves and such
